Miracle Dynamics, part of Eque2 Limited, is excited to launch MiraclePay, the first Payroll solution for Microsoft’s cloud-based Dynamics 365 Business Central solution.
MiraclePay is a well-established payroll solution which up until now has been built within the Microsoft Dynamics NAV / Business Central On-Premise platform. The existing solution is widely used by small to mid-market and enterprise companies to process payroll from 10 to 5,000 employees and beyond. MiraclePay is used across a wide range of industries including, but not limited to, construction, manufacturing, retail, hospitality, accounting and sport and leisure.

MiraclePay is built within Dynamics 365 Business Central to allow the payroll function to become part of a company’s overall ERP solution. Managing all aspects of an individual’s payroll, MiraclePay ensures managers and payroll teams receive regular automated updates on tasks and warnings though their Role Centre.
Businesses can gain peace of mind on the security of their sensitive payroll data as MiraclePay provides additional levels of specific Payroll-based security in addition to standard Business Central policies, ensuring sensitive information is only seen by authorised individuals.
MiraclePay also links to HMRC to automate submissions and validate employee information. With all legislative annual changes being managed by the Eque2 team.
